Career Role Description
Bioinformatics Scientist Develops and applies bioinformatics tools and techniques for data analysis in genomics, proteomics, and other life sciences. High demand in pharmaceutical and biotech sectors.
Data Scientist (Bioinformatics focus) Utilizes bioinformatics skills and statistical modeling to extract insights from large biological datasets. Strong analytical and programming skills are crucial. High demand across various sectors.
Computational Biologist Applies computational methods to study biological systems. Expertise in algorithms, sequence analysis, and statistical modeling is key. Growing demand in academia and industry.
Bioinformatics Analyst Analyzes biological data using bioinformatics tools. Strong data analysis and interpretation skills are essential. Good career prospects in research institutions and companies.
